About GTMAY

Founded in 1955 and headquartered in Mexico City, Grupo TMM, S.A.B. has evolved into a diversified logistics and transportation company operating primarily in Mexico. The company's operations are structured around four key segments: Specialized Maritime Transportation, Logistics, Ports and Terminals, and Warehousing. The Specialized Maritime Transportation segment provides services to the Mexican offshore oil industry, transporting petroleum products and other commodities in both Mexican and international waters. The Logistics segment offers consulting, analytical, and outsourcing services, including supply chain management and intermodal transport. Through its Ports and Terminals segment, Grupo TMM operates port facilities in Tuxpan, Tampico, and Acapulco, providing loading, unloading, storage, and shipping agency services. The Warehousing segment offers warehousing and bonded warehousing facility management. As of March 2022, Grupo TMM operated a fleet of 30 vessels, including product and chemical tankers and offshore supply vessels. Grupo TMM plays a crucial role in supporting Mexico's industrial and energy sectors through its integrated logistics and transportation solutions.

What They Do

  • Provides maritime transportation services, including offshore vessels for the Mexican oil industry.
  • Operates tankers for transporting petroleum products in Mexican and international waters.
  • Transports liquid chemical and vegetable oil cargos between the United States and Mexico.
  • Transports unpackaged commodities such as steel between South America, the Caribbean, and Mexico.
  • Offers ship repair services through floating drydocks.
  • Provides port agent services to vessel owners and operators in Mexican ports.
  • Manages warehousing and bonded warehousing facilities.
  • Offers logistics services, including consulting, supply chain management, and intermodal transport.

Grupo TMM, S.A.B. ADR Information Unsponsored

An American Depositary Receipt (ADR) is a certificate representing shares of a foreign company that trades on U.S. stock exchanges. GTMAY is an ADR, meaning it allows U.S. investors to invest in Grupo TMM, S.A.B. without directly dealing with the Mexican stock market. The ADR is denominated in U.S. dollars, simplifying trading and reporting for U.S. investors.

Currency Risk: Investing in GTMAY exposes U.S. investors to currency risk, as the value of the ADR can be affected by fluctuations in the exchange rate between the U.S. dollar and the Mexican peso. If the peso depreciates against the dollar, the value of the ADR may decrease, even if the underlying shares of Grupo TMM, S.A.B. remain stable in peso terms. Investors may want to evaluate this currency risk when evaluating the potential returns from GTMAY.
Tax Implications: Dividends paid on GTMAY shares are subject to foreign dividend withholding tax in Mexico. The standard withholding tax rate is typically around 30%, but this may be reduced under tax treaties between Mexico and the United States. U.S. investors may be able to claim a foreign tax credit on their U.S. tax return for the amount of foreign tax withheld.

GTMAY OTC Market Information

The OTC Other tier represents the lowest tier of the over-the-counter (OTC) market, indicating that Grupo TMM, S.A.B. has the least stringent listing requirements and may not be fully compliant with U.S. reporting standards. Unlike stocks listed on the NYSE or NASDAQ, OTC Other stocks often have limited financial disclosure and may be subject to higher risks. Investors should exercise caution and conduct thorough due diligence before investing in OTC Other stocks.

  • OTC Tier: OTC Other
  • Disclosure Status: Unknown
Liquidity: Liquidity in GTMAY shares is likely to be limited due to its OTC listing and small market capitalization. Trading volume may be low, and the bid-ask spread may be wide, making it difficult to buy or sell shares at desired prices. Investors may experience delays in executing trades and may incur higher transaction costs. The limited liquidity increases the risk of price volatility and makes it challenging to exit positions quickly.
